Planning and Preparation🫶🏻

Months of excitement led up to our well-organized trip to Moalboal. We chose the destination, set the date, and made sure everything was ready. With our sinking fund and careful budgeting, each of us had ₱1,200 to spend, ensuring a stress-free journey.

IMG_5396.jpeg

IMG_5400.jpeg

The day before departure, we secured a comfortable two-room booking at FFG Eden Resort and gathered all the groceries and supplies we needed. Renting a pickup truck made it easy to transport our luggage and provisions. It will also lessen the hassle for us.

The Journey Begins🎣

On the morning of our trip, we gathered at Kate’s house to pack up and prepare our meals. The pickup truck arrived at 8:30 AM, and by 10:30 AM, we were on the road to Moalboal. We spent the ride catching up, sharing stories, and looking forward to our destination.

IMG_5415.jpeg
Stopping for Lunch in Barili🥡

After a couple of hours on the road, we already entered Barili, and we decided to stop near Shamrock Pension House to have lunch because our tummies can’t take it anymore. We are all starving, so Sir Mandal bought 2 whole chickens in Chooks To Go and “hanging rice” or poso. We pray first before eating, it becomes silent when everyone is eating, especially if the foods are all delicious.

IMG_5418.jpeg

IMG_5419.jpeg

We enjoyed Chooks To Go chicken with "poso" (hanging rice) and "guso" (sea moss) that is seasoned perfectly by vinegar, onion, and many more aromatics. It was a satisfying meal that fueled us for the rest of the journey. We took a rest for a moment before continuing the ride to Moalboal. Arrival at FFG Eden Resort📍

After a few more hours of travel, we finally arrived at FFG Eden Resort in Moalboal. Sir Mandal already took charge of asking about our booking and rooms; after that, they also explained to us their rules at the resort, and we understood everything properly.

IMG_5430.jpeg

IMG_5434.jpeg

We headed to the first room, which is good for 5 packs, so we immediately decided that we would take that room for us girls since we are 5; the first room is called “Lumod Suite.” We headed to the second room next, which is the big one, which is good for 8 packs, and the boys would take it since they are 6; the second room is called “Butanding Suite.” It all sounds cute.
